Accounts to be kept. 24. Report and accounts. 25. Regulations. CHAPTER 276 UGANDA LAW SOCIETY ACT. Commencement : 27 December, 1956. An Act to make provision for the incorporation of the Uganda Law Society and to make provision for its powers, duties and responsibilities. PART I INTERPRETATION. 1. In this Act, unless the context otherwise requires— ( a ) "advocate" has the same meaning as in the Advocates Act; ( b ) "council" means the council established under section 9; ( c ) "Law Council" means the Law Council established under section 2 of the Advocates Act; ( d ) "rules committee" means the Rules Committee established under section 40 of the Judicature Act; ( e ) "society" means the body corporate established under section 2; ( f ) "special resolution" means a resolution passed by a majority of not less than two-thirds of such members of the society as, being entitled to do so, vote in person or by proxy at a general meeting of the society, duly convened with full notice of the intention to propose such resolution.
